Protecting Your Home’s First Line of Defense

Windows and glass doors are among the most vulnerable parts of a home during a hurricane. High winds and airborne debris can crack or shatter glass, creating openings that allow wind and rain to enter.

Storm shutters act as a protective barrier, helping shield these openings from impact and reducing the likelihood of window failure during a storm.

Reducing Water Intrusion

Once a window or door is compromised, wind-driven rain can quickly enter the home. Water intrusion can damage flooring, drywall, furniture, electronics, and personal belongings.

By helping keep windows intact, storm shutters provide an additional layer of protection against moisture damage that can continue long after the storm has passed.

Helping Maintain Structural Integrity

Many homeowners don’t realize that broken windows can affect more than just the immediate area around the glass. When strong winds enter a home through damaged openings, internal pressure can increase dramatically.

This pressure may contribute to roof damage, structural stress, and additional failures throughout the property. Storm shutters help reduce these risks by protecting critical entry points and maintaining the building envelope.

Added Security and Peace of Mind

Storm shutters can also provide benefits outside of hurricane season. Many shutter systems offer an added layer of security against unauthorized entry while increasing privacy for homeowners.

For seasonal residents and vacation property owners, this extra protection can be especially valuable.
